The advent of 5G technology brings faster and more reliable wireless connectivity, which has a significant impact on dry block calibrators. With 5G, dry block calibrators can be connected to a network more seamlessly, enabling real - time data transfer and remote control with minimal latency.
This enhanced connectivity allows technicians to monitor and control dry block calibrators from remote locations, even in areas with high data traffic. For example, in a large industrial complex, multiple dry block calibrators can be connected to a central system via 5G, and technicians can access and manage them from a single control room.
Moreover, 5G enables the integration of dry block calibrators with other smart devices and systems, creating a more interconnected calibration ecosystem. This can lead to more efficient calibration processes, as data from different sources can be shared and analyzed in real - time to optimize the calibration workflow.
